Wait...the Mesa guys are calling SkyWest guys scabs while it is perfectly fine for them to continue putting millions in the pockets of a convicted felon?

A Hawaii bankruptcy judge’s recent finding ordering Phoenix’s Mesa Air Group to pay $80 million for misusing a rival’s confidential data isn’t the first blot on the résumé of Jonathan G. Ornstein, who runs the airline. As FORBES reported years ago, the SEC in 1992 upheld a fine and multiyear suspension as a stockbroker–his prior career. The agency cited unauthorized trading, misrepresentation and frustrating investigators. Ornstein’s official disciplinary record printout back then: 21 feet long.
